Melvin Donald Gillam, master electrician

July 12, 2021

Melvin Donald Gillam, 90, or “Don” as everyone knew him, passed away Tuesday, July 6, 2021 at home. 

Don was born in Tyrone, Pa., to the late Melvin Marvin “Red” and Maude Waite Gillam Feb. 6, 1931. In addition to his parents, Don was preceded by a daughter, Susan Hanel in 1990; a sister: Beverly “Boots” Smith; and a stepbrother: Robert Gillam.

Don served in the U.S. Army as a paratrooper and was a veteran of the Korean War.  He married Mildred Cathell, and together they raised three children.  He became a master electrician and worked with engineers at American Hoechst research facility in New Jersey. He conducted safety seminars around the country. Don was a lifelong Mason. He was a dedicated Republican.  Most of all, he was devoted to his family, liked to fix things, and tinker with the irrigation system at his home in Georgetown. He was a marvelous “Mr. Fix-it.”

Don is survived by his bride and love of his life, Mildred, sharing 68 years together.  Also surviving are his loving daughters: Karen Gillam of Lewes and Patricia Ragan of Charlestown, Md.  He is survived by a brother: Ken Gillam of Reedsville, Pa.; three grandchildren: Lauren Hanel, Nathan Hanel, and John Thomas Ragan; as well as two great-grandchildren, two nieces and one nephew.
